Anton Dominik Fernkorn emerged as one of the most respected sculptors of his generation, bringing vitality and dynamism to public monuments across the Habsburg realms. His ability to capture both heroic grandeur and humane detail helped give the capital striking memorials that celebrated the ideals of the era.

He continued to produce works that blended classical training with contemporary spirit until his passing in 1878, and his legacy endures among the stately sculptures of Vienna. Fernkorn was interred in the Vienna Central Cemetery, where his art remains a testament to his skill.
